Understanding Fluorine-Lined Pipe Fittings
Fluorine-lined pipe fittings, as the name suggests, feature a lining made from fluoropolymers, such as PTFE (Polytetrafluoroethylene). This unique material is known for its chemical resistance and high-temperature stability, making it an excellent choice for plumbing, chemical processing, and even food industries. The Benefits of Using Fluorine-Lined Pipe Fittings
Superior Chemical Resistance: One of the most significant advantages of fluorine-lined pipe fittings is their ability to resist corrosive chemicals. According to a study by the American Society for Testing and Materials (ASTM), fluoropolymer linings can withstand a wider range of chemicals than conventional materials, which translates to reduced maintenance costs and fewer failures.
High-Temperature Stability: Fluorine-lined pipe fittings maintain their integrity under extreme temperatures, generally ranging from -100°F to 500°F. This makes them an excellent option for industries that operate in high-thermal environments, such as power plants and pharmaceutical manufacturing.
Low Friction: The smooth surface of fluorine linings reduces friction, making fluid flow more efficient. This efficiency can save energy in a time when businesses are looking to lower costs and improve sustainability.
